Parents Worship Day on 14 Feb: A Campaign by Asharam Ji Bapu for the Global Well-Being
Matawan, New Jersey (PRWEB) February 11, 2016 -- The 14th day of February is set to be celebrated again as "Parents Worship Day” or “Divine Valentine’s Day” across the Globe. The idea of celebrating love by appreciating parents on this day has been initiated by an Indian spiritual Guru -Saint Asharam Ji Bapu. Why Parents’ Worship Day instead of Valentine’s Day?
As per Innocenti Report Card issue No.3, in 28 developed countries, 1.25 million teenage girls become pregnant, out of which 500,000 choose to undergo an abortion and 750,000 become teenage mothers. The US has the highest teen pregnancy rate in the industrialized world, as per Candie's Foundation. Furthermore, eight out of ten, teen fathers do not marry the mother of their child. In the US alone, 3 million teenage boys and girls get afflicted with Sexually Transmitted Diseases (STDs).

The campaign of Parents Worship Day celebration has received notable endorsements and coverage internationally; that includes the US Senator Sam Thompson, Nashville Mayor Megan Barry, The President of India- Dr. Pranab Mukherjee, Bollywood stars- Govinda, Shreyas Talpade, Mugdha Godse to name a few.
Apart from this, the UK media BBC has also covered the idea of “Parents Worship Day” for the last two years while it remained a worldwide trending topic on Twitter.
Parents Worship Day celebrations have become official in all schools and colleges in Chhattisgarh- a state of India. Along with Chhattisgarh, the event has received appreciation letters from various state governments, including Himachal Pradesh, Haryana, Gujarat, and Karnataka as well as from the hundreds of school Principals and support from many saints across the country, per the reference given on ashram official website.
